headed up to Titus early this am to ski the Mother Lode -- 30 inches blower powski -- i mean friggin deep and light

The drive up was unreal----the closer we got to Chasm Falls the roads were like funnels and the farkin banks were 8 ft high. Roofs were laden with marshmellow frosting and the trees, man the trees were unreal . We pulled into the lot and they were shoveling the lodge roofs

I forgot the damn camera too in my rush and excitement to get there .

We Had 30 runs all over the damn mtn today .It was hip deep in the woods and knee deep where the trails were left ungroomed . The "Red Group Powder Piggies "were flyin today and grins were everywhere . Many Kids blew off school as there were many young guns all over the mtn too.

Damn The mtn will be good till May IF they don't run out of skiers first .
